STEM organizations are entities dedicated to promoting education, career development, and community engagement in the fields of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ics (STEM). These organizations often operate through clubs, nonprofits, professional societies, or outreach programs to inspire interest among students and professionals, foster innovation, and address societal challenges related to STEM disciplines.
Key Features
- Focus on education and outreach in STEM fields
- Offers mentorship, workshops, and networking opportunities
- Typically composed of students, educators, professionals, and enthusiasts
- Engages in advocacy for STEM literacy and funding
- Often collaborates with schools, universities, governments, and industry partners
